Author's note
words in italic = memories (aka stuff in the video)
This piece is done in Takumi's POV.
The air outside was crisp and cold, and snow started to fall from the starry night sky. I was at home, enjoying a cup of hot chocolate I made for myself. Dad just came home with some fancy pastry. Wow, I haven't had those stuff in ages. He also had a mysterious USB drive in hand. I was a bit surprised. He never had any job related to electronics.
"Merry Christmas, son," he said softly.
He left the USB which he was previously holding on the dining table along with the cake, then went into the kitchen to get the dishes.
I examined the little gadget in confusion.
"Plug it into our computer and have a look." Dad remarked. "It's a gift for you..I guess?"
He sounded so hesitant, but I still did what he said, and left me mesmerized.
All were videos of our past; happy and sad moments captured in moving pictures. 
——————
People say 'Christmas isn't Christmas without presents'. Coming from a single-parent family, the best we could ask for is to be together, always.
I clicked into the videos, one by one. Probably because I didn't really know how to smile, I looked weird in 90% of the videos.
There was that one video which caught my eye. We were going sledding. Also, I spotted our AE86 in the background.
Yeah, The AE86. I still miss the times when our Trueno was on the go.
"Will it snow tomorrow, dad?" I literally asked every day.
"I know, I know, son. You want to go sledding, right? We can go tomorrow..I guess if the snow's thick enough.."
I squealed in joy.
So the next day he took me up Mt. Akina, and had a wonderful morning up there.
"Can we go faster, dad?"  I asked every second.
"Let me see.." He pulled on random strings and tried different positions. "Aw drats, there's no gas pedal on the sled.."  
I guess that was the beginning of my racer's career, I was longing for the sense of excitement every time we sped down the mountain.
We slid down the mountain time after time, until I was too tired to walk anymore. He carried me back to the car as I fell asleep on his shoulders.
There was also old footage of my dad racing down Mt. Akina while I was asleep in the backseat because he forgot to stop the recording. 
As simple as that. Nothing really special happened, but that was my first time going sledding, which was worth mentioning.
——————
I clicked on another video, and pointed at one of the people.
"Dad, who is this?" I asked him as he was coming out from the kitchen.
"Ah, Yuichi..I still missed the times when he actually looked young," He sighed. "We have all grew old I guess.."
Yuichi was my dad's friend back when he was racing, and also my boss when I served as a gas station attendant back then. This video was about me and my dad having hotpot with Yuichi and some of his colleagues at the lounge in the newly-renovated Gas Station. It looked much cleaner back then.
"So much food!" I exclaimed. "Can we really finish this all? My teacher always told me that it's not good to throw away food."
"It's ok, Takumi. We can do it," My dad reassured me.
After a while, my dad had fo leave for a moment to get the tofu for the hotpot. The screen went black.
He came back and the video started playing again.
"Tofu again? Dad, we've been eating this every night!! I'm kinda bored with this.." I complained.
My dad said nothing but went back to the shop again and this time came back with a bottle of sesame sauce.
"This will make it taste better, son. Try it." He patted me on the head and fed me a spoonful of tofu with sauce into my mouth.
"Oh my god dad, are you a magician?! It's so good!!"
"Umm..condiments make everything better..but you could only have tofu with sauce this time. It's pretty unhealthy if you eat like that every day."
"Yay!! Tofu is the best!!!" I said, without fully understanding what my dad said.
He closed the mouth of the bottle of sauce and smiled a bit. 
It's not always that he smiled.
——————
I scrolled to the bottom and found another one. That's probably the only time I have built a snowman in my life. Global warming sure did hit hard on us. 
I was rolling a snowball on the floor outside our old house in the countryside.
"Dad, help me push this!! It's so heavy!"
"What's the magic word?"
"Please!!"
My dad grunted in the cold and pushed the snowball for me.
I ran back into the warehouse (yeah we used to have a warehouse) for ornaments to decorate the snowman, and came out with a bag of coal and some wooden sticks.
"Dad, I'm going to build a panda-shaped snowman!! Just you watch!!" 
He gave me a slight smile in the distance.
I stacked more smaller snowballs on the big one which Dad did for me. 
Just as I was struggling to put the ears on the head of the snowman cause I’m not tall enough, a pair of warm hands lifted me up. 
"Oh, daddy, it tickles!!" He laughed a little bit in response. "This is going to be the best snowman ever!!”
Till dusk we were busying with the snowman, we nearly forgot to get back inside for dinner.
“This panda-shaped snowman will stand here and guard our home tonight. Me and daddy will be safe and sound.” I laughed as I rushed back into the house.
——————
I clicked on some more videos and that was basically it.
Cutting the piece of cake on my table, I looked back at how far I have gone. This is my last Christmas in Japan, next spring I'll be flying to England to pursue my career as a pro racer. 
Dad, this was a nice gift. I guess the truth behind your mysterious 'cameramen' and suspicious activity on your phone is now revealed then. I remember dad always pulled out his phone and pressed some random buttons for a while almost every meal. I could see them all in one drive now. 
I'm really sorry as well; I know my dad's almost always drinking when he's free, and I even got forced to drive. However, if he didn't do so, I never would have so many opportunities, meeting so many great people, exploring different prefectures and mountain passes in Japan.
Thanks, Dad, I'm going to try my best in the UK, and I’ll definitely miss you a lot. Merry Christmas!
